Some recipes that I have tried recently are:
Shrimp and Grits : I did a revised version of this because.  I first cooked some bacon and then cooked the shrimp in a mixture of bacon fat and butter.  I did not add parsley or lemon and instead of Parmesan cheese I used a little bit of Colby jack.  Of course to add some richness to it I added heavy cream, just a little to make it soft and creamy.  This is the second time I have had grits, and I must say they are pretty good!
Shrimp and Grits Bites : Because I had leftover shrimp and grits I turned them into an small bite appetizer.  They were really simple, just put the grits into mini muffin tins and bake at 350 for 30 mins.  Probably should have baked only 20-25 minutes but they were still good. Topped with the remaining bacon, shrimp, and green onions.  To try to add some moistness to it I drizzled the bacon butter over it.
Chicks in a Blanket : This is a spin on Pigs in a blanket or the little smokies wrapped in bacon.  It was really easy to make, just wrap chicken with bacon and top with a glaze.  I did not have honey so my sauce consisted of soy sauce, brown sugar, and Dijon mustard. I also used chicken thigh meat instead of breasts. 
Caprese Skewers : I have made these before, but it had been awhile. This time instead of making a vinaigrette I used a prepared salad dressing...The semi-homemade way!
Red Curry Coconut  Noodles : I love red curry when I get it at restaurants...but, my version was not so good. It was still edible, but I tried to substitute the Coconut Milk that we drink instead of the thick canned coconut milk.  I used way too many noodles, who knew a box of rice noodles would fill a whole stock pot! So, needless to say, there was way too many noodles that soaked up all the sauce.  I don't think I will try this again, it was edible but not what I would want to make again.
Skinny Chicken Enchiladas : I was able to change this recipe a little bit so that I could have it during my 10 Day no Gluten and Dairy Diet.  I had to use corn tortillas and Veggie Slice pepper jack cheese.  It was good and I could not even taste the difference between the fake cheese and real cheese.
